It's also important to read the instructions provided in the medication guide to ensure safe and effective use.It's also important to read the instructions provided in the medication guide to ensure safe use.Orlistat has been found to be an effective prescription weight loss pill for individuals with obesity. It works by blocking the absorption of fat in the body, which leads to a reduction in overall caloric intake. Studies have shown that individuals who take Orlistat in combination with a reduced-calorie diet and exercise program lose more weight compared to those who only follow the diet and exercise program. In fact, Orlistat has been found to result in a 5-10% reduction in body weight within one year of use. However, it is important to note that Orlistat is not a miracle drug and should be used in conjunction with a healthy lifestyle. Additionally, the amount of weight loss can vary from individual to individual, and some may see more significant results than others.

Cost of Orlistat
Orlistat, as a prescription weight loss pill, can be costly depending on where it is purchased. The branded version, Xenical, can cost around $200 for a one-month supply, while the generic version can cost around $60 to $70 for the same amount. The cost may not be covered by insurance since weight loss drugs are not always considered medically necessary. However, some insurance plans may cover a portion of the cost. Additionally, there are online pharmacies that offer discounts on Orlistat, but caution should be exercised when buying from these sources. Overall, the cost of Orlistat can be a barrier for some individuals seeking weight loss treatment, but it is important to weigh the potential benefits against the cost and explore other options if necessary.
Availability of Orlistat
Orlistat, as a prescription weight loss medication, is available in many countries, including the United States, through a doctor's prescription. However, it is not available over the counter in all countries. In some places, such as the UK, Orlistat is available over the counter in a lower dose form known as Alli. This allows for greater accessibility for individuals seeking to use Orlistat for weight loss. Ultimately, the availability of Orlistat will depend on the regulations set by each individual country or region.

Tablets like (the brand name for Orlistat) work by reducing the amount of fat your body absorbs. Ordinarily, fats are broken down during the digestion process by enzymes called lipases. Xenical prevents these enzymes from working effectively, limiting how much fat your body is able to absorb. The remaining, undigested fat is then excreted.
